Output d17c8361ca9172ce53c1eba0d5767a16a19122ce05605ad0ee226fb298b47750:23

value
658088270
script pubkey
OP_0 OP_PUSHBYTES_32 55a094f0b4b70519ff6bc4f0b93d49ed2358914a8945c6fbafd871309226c3fa
address
bc1q2ksffu95kuz3nlmtcnctj02fa5343y2239zud7a0mpcnpy3xc0aq6ejq23
transaction
d17c8361ca9172ce53c1eba0d5767a16a19122ce05605ad0ee226fb298b47750
spent
true